Understanding the Pressure Relief Valve
Before diving into troubleshooting, it’s crucial to understand the purpose of the pressure relief valve (PRV). This safety device is designed to prevent dangerous pressure buildup within the hot water tank. Excessive pressure, often caused by overheating or a malfunctioning temperature and pressure relief (T&P) valve, can lead to tank rupture. The PRV acts as a safeguard, releasing excess pressure and preventing this catastrophic failure. When the pressure exceeds a preset limit, typically around 150 PSI, the valve automatically opens, releasing hot water and relieving the pressure.
Common Causes of PRV Activation
Several factors can trigger the pressure relief valve to open repeatedly on a new hot water heater. These range from simple user errors to more complex mechanical issues. Let’s examine some of the most frequent culprits:
- Excessive Water Pressure: The water pressure entering your home might be too high. This is a common issue, and a simple pressure gauge can confirm this. If your home’s water pressure consistently exceeds the recommended range (typically 40-60 PSI), it can overwhelm the hot water heater.
- Faulty Temperature and Pressure Relief (T&P) Valve: While less common in a brand-new water heater, a faulty T&P valve can still be the source. A malfunctioning valve might not properly regulate the temperature or pressure, leading to frequent PRV activation. It’s important to check the valve itself for proper operation.
- Sediment Buildup: Even a new water heater can experience sediment buildup if the water supply contains minerals or impurities. This sediment can restrict water flow, leading to increased pressure and triggering the PRV. Regular flushing of the tank can prevent this problem.
- Overheating: If the water heater’s thermostat is malfunctioning or set too high, the water can overheat, causing pressure to build. Checking the thermostat setting and ensuring its proper functionality is essential.
- Expansion Tank Issues (if applicable): Some hot water systems incorporate an expansion tank to accommodate water expansion as it heats. A malfunctioning or improperly sized expansion tank can contribute to excessive pressure.
Troubleshooting Steps
Troubleshooting a constantly opening PRV involves a systematic approach. Start with the simplest checks before moving to more complex solutions. Safety should always be your top priority when working with hot water systems. Always turn off the power supply to the water heater before starting any repairs.
Step 1: Check the Water Pressure
Use a pressure gauge to measure the water pressure at a cold water tap. If the pressure consistently exceeds 60 PSI, consider installing a pressure regulator to lower the water pressure entering your home. This is often the simplest and most effective solution. High water pressure affects the entire plumbing system and is a common cause of PRV activation.
Step 2: Inspect the T&P Valve
Carefully inspect the T&P valve itself. Look for any signs of damage, leaks, or corrosion. A malfunctioning T&P valve needs to be replaced. While this is relatively straightforward, it is recommended to consult a professional plumber if you’re unsure how to replace it safely and correctly. Improper installation can lead to further complications.
Step 3: Check the Thermostat Setting
Ensure the water heater’s thermostat is set to the manufacturer’s recommended temperature, typically around 120°F (49°C). Setting the thermostat too high can cause the water to overheat, leading to excessive pressure. A faulty thermostat should be replaced to prevent further overheating incidents.
Step 4: Flush the Water Heater
Sediment buildup can significantly restrict water flow and contribute to pressure buildup. Consult your water heater’s manual for instructions on how to properly flush the tank. This is a preventative measure to maintain the efficiency and longevity of your water heater. Regular flushing is recommended, even if you don’t have a PRV problem.
Step 5: Inspect the Expansion Tank (if applicable)
If your system includes an expansion tank, check its pressure and condition. A properly functioning expansion tank should have a pre-charged pressure. If the pressure is low or the tank shows signs of damage, it might need replacement or repair. A poorly functioning expansion tank is often overlooked, but can cause persistent problems.
